Distributed Systems
Distributed Systems Courses and Certifications
Distributed systems are the backbone of modern computing, enabling applications to function seamlessly across multiple servers, data centers, and even continents. Learning about distributed systems equips you with essential knowledge for designing, managing, and scaling applications that are critical to today’s digital infrastructure. If you’re looking to master this area of technology, EdCroma offers a comprehensive distributed systems course designed to give you in-depth understanding and hands-on experience.
Why Enroll in a Distributed Systems Course?
Distributed systems play a key role in cloud computing, big data analytics, and large-scale web applications. By taking a distributed systems course, you will learn how to manage and optimize distributed architectures, ensuring fault tolerance, scalability, and performance. The demand for professionals with expertise in distributed systems continues to grow as organizations move towards more complex and scalable infrastructures.
What You Will Learn in EdCroma’s Distributed Systems Course
At EdCroma, our distributed systems course covers a wide range of essential topics that will prepare you for a successful career in the field:
- Introduction to Distributed Systems: Learn the basic concepts, including distributed computing models, architectures, and design principles.
- Concurrency and Synchronization: Understand how distributed systems handle multiple processes and synchronization across nodes.
- Fault Tolerance: Learn how to design systems that can withstand failures and continue to operate reliably.
- Distributed Databases and Storage: Explore how data is stored, retrieved, and managed in distributed systems.
- Consensus Algorithms: Dive into Paxos and Raft, the most popular algorithms that help distributed systems agree on a single state despite failures.
Cloud and Edge Computing: Discover how distributed systems power cloud platforms like AWS, Azure, and Google Cloud, as well as edge computing solutions.
Showing the single result
Building Distributed .NET Apps with Orleans
This course will teach you how to build scalable, high-available and fault tolerant applications with Microsoft Orleans.
Who Should Enroll in This Course?
- Software Developers: If you are already familiar with application development, learning about distributed systems will enhance your ability to work on large-scale systems.
- System Administrators: Gain the expertise needed to manage, maintain, and troubleshoot complex distributed environments.
- IT Professionals: Broaden your knowledge of cloud architectures, microservices, and system reliability.
- Students and Enthusiasts: Start with the basics and advance towards more complex concepts to understand how distributed systems function in real-world environments.
Best Distributed Systems Courses at EdCroma
At EdCroma, we offer some of the best distributed systems courses, designed to cater to all levels of learners. Whether you’re new to the topic or already have some experience, our course is structured to provide deep knowledge and practical skills. Our platform also provides free distributed systems courses, enabling beginners to get started without any financial barriers.
Free Distributed Systems Courses with Certification
If you’re looking to gain skills without a major financial investment, EdCroma’s best distributed systems course free options are a great start. You can enroll in our best distributed systems course free online to learn fundamental concepts. Upon completion, you’ll receive a free certificate that is recognized by industry professionals and adds value to your resume.
Why Choose EdCroma for Your Distributed Systems Course?
- Expert-Led Curriculum: Our courses are developed by industry experts with years of practical experience in distributed systems.
- Hands-On Projects: Gain real-world skills by working on distributed systems projects that replicate industry challenges.
- Flexible Learning: Learn at your own pace, with both free and paid course options, giving you the flexibility to upskill in a way that suits your schedule.
- Certification: Earn a globally recognized certificate upon completion, which enhances your professional credibility.
Career Opportunities After Completing the Course
After completing EdCroma’s distributed systems course, you can pursue various roles such as:
- Cloud Architect: Design and manage cloud infrastructure that utilizes distributed systems.
- System Reliability Engineer: Ensure that large-scale applications are resilient, secure, and scalable.
- Backend Developer: Work on backend systems that power distributed applications.
- DevOps Engineer: Implement and maintain distributed systems to support continuous integration and deployment pipelines.
Enroll Now in the Best Distributed Systems Course
Whether you’re looking to enhance your career, broaden your technical knowledge, or simply explore new concepts, EdCroma offers the best-distributed systems course free online for all learners. Start learning today and gain a competitive edge in the world of cloud computing, big data, and distributed architectures.
Enroll today in EdCroma’s best distributed systems course free online with certificate and unlock exciting career opportunities in this growing field.